Title :
Analysis and Simulation of Balanced Low Noise Amplifier

Abstract :
We give an analysis of balanced low noise amplifier (LNA) which has good voltage standing wave ratio (VSWR) performance, higher linearity and good stability. A mathematic model of balanced LNA has been setup and an analysis of gain, noise figure (NF) and VSWR based on it is presented. According to analysis in time domain and simulation in advance design system (ADS), the unbalance of gain, NF and VSWR will affect the performance of the balanced LNA module. It gets a zero reflection on condition that its two branches totally balanced. 10 dB difference of gains causes NF increased by 1 dB.
